## Deployment

Nightwren is the scheduler that runs nightly data backfills for the Corvid analytics pipeline. It deploys as a single systemd unit on the batch host and picks up jobs from the manifest directory at startup. Backfills run between 01:00 and 05:00 local time; anything unfinished is requeued for the next window. Before starting the service, review the configuration values below.

config for yajep-tafof:
[rusath]
team = julmir
access_code = ac_fe37fd
host = rusath.novactech.test
port = 8000
owner = pelmir.weneth
peer = oliwyn.olvarqdyn.internal

## Configuration: Poolmere connection pooling

Poolmere manages the shared Postgres pool for the Ternbridge services. Set `POOLMERE_MAX_CONNECTIONS` conservatively — the database instance caps at 200, and exceeding it during a release will stall health checks. `POOLMERE_IDLE_TIMEOUT_MS` should stay at 30000 unless load testing says otherwise. The pooler also requires an admin credential to register with the coordinator. In the release `.env`, after the timeout setting, place that credential on the next line.

secret setting of tawif-tajop: COURIER_KEY13=819c65d82d2bd

# Customer Concentration Risk — Restricted: Managers Only

For the incoming director: Orvatek currently derives a disproportionate share of revenue from a single account, Pellan Group. Contract renewal falls in Q2. Loss would materially affect the Northgate division. Mitigation: diversify via the Skerrow pipeline; accelerate two mid-tier prospects. Do not reference this page externally. The confidential plan addressing this exposure appears immediately below.

internal memo for kawip-hadug: Headcount on the Wenwyn team goes from 7 to 140 by the end of January. Gross margin on Wenwyn came in at 20 percent against a plan of 15 percent.